The Allure of Betting on Sports

As sports leagues increasingly embrace gambling, fans find themselves caught in a web of emotional investments. The statistic that nearly 50 million Americans placed bets on the Super Bowl in 2023 illustrates the phenomenon. In fact, the American Gaming Association reported that sports betting revenue has skyrocketed, exceeding $4 billion in 2022 alone, thanks to the legalization of sports gambling in numerous states.

The NBA and Gambling: A Complicated Relationship

The NBA, a league that has openly supported gambling, faces challenges like the recent scandal involving players allegedly violating betting protocols. This controversy raises critical questions about the integrity of the game and the responsibilities of athletes in a betting-centric environment. Fans may feel torn between their loyalty to their teams and the realities of betting influences.
